Type
ORACLE
Validation date
2023-10-27 07: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03362,
    "usd": 0.03551
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000152332BBF54968574BFB1ED893A76856110A4A46D51129F47C4FDDFEEBFF09784

Previous signature

51223D5520AFD757B959826FF94F0C2959393E42D9775C64215A25563AE5FC8AE98DC6D10CD971DF7C91DADF61605B3FBB211F8EDC2559E0AC61609E83C10408

Origin signature

3046022100830614E15B22B3D099D4385812E0321A82E36A0D66E33B0679F5C41307E8DB4C022100BD5DA8FBDF78660311241F6573D3F17E866D460D525719BC4319836DEAA438B3

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00E653C767B597C900B0C91FFC968DB448F686E5E833A6ECA7988268DA6871B166

Coordinator signature

2C649C3D25308EEDA8716EDC8E51652B1B566FDAF83DEB1749111459A15191A3ABE1D26CE3E9C09D26CB9BD2E250AE38A3DB2D1541C414D9EF12CF890C6F7B0A

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

7DB4727C980264012AB908A0B7928D9465286847B1EDCF5EA8FA49F9E7B4060D5821961772C8D764AE77751D74F92A2667E40AD8FDCB9DC8F2E2D7ABFCAC4908

Validator #2 public key

000132E7DEA2FB77A1754C11C3E111373AD21F85CFD7CB31BF4820795646DB0E8FE0

Validator #2 signature

D590698041EAC7397FF5BB43BC1F94734F1F8D9D3269D0CD8BEF7EDB10213E1430AD8D18241262DE09B7949F1843401285DC4F3E4CC985D2479F45EA616B1B03